🌞 Why Vitamin C is Crucial in Summer

1. Boosts Immunity

Summer might not be flu season, but infections, allergies, and digestive issues are still common. Vitamin C strengthens your immune system by supporting white blood cell production—your body’s natural defense team.

2. Fights Heat-Induced Fatigue

Vitamin C helps your body manage oxidative stress (damage caused by heat and sun exposure). It also plays a role in energy metabolism, which means it can help reduce tiredness and fatigue on long, hot days.

3. Promotes Glowing Skin

Too much sun exposure can damage your skin and lead to premature aging. Vitamin C is a natural antioxidant that:

  • Fights free radicals from UV rays
  • Helps in collagen production for firm, youthful skin
  • Reduces sun spots and pigmentation

4. Aids Iron Absorption

Sweating a lot in summer? You may lose minerals like iron more quickly. Vitamin C helps your body absorb iron better from plant-based foods, keeping your energy levels up and reducing the risk of anemia
